Output e89c517e3f7566eb69457731b56e4c360c0634ce945ee9f0c6d0c48bc6d3532e:2

value
71883354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8035834ff13f698be59c2ed98b6ffd928241d36d OP_EQUAL
address
3DNvXF12PFVeQMqVRAjYLVMkuyEPAvEdUX
transaction
e89c517e3f7566eb69457731b56e4c360c0634ce945ee9f0c6d0c48bc6d3532e